On the basis of the BMW 328, Ernst Loof, Schorsch Meyer and Lorenz Dietrich build the first 'BMW Veritas' and begin an incomparable series of racetrack victories in 1949:
A Veritas wins its first race in front of 300,000 fascinated spectators in the first race after the Second World War. All in all, the successful racing car wins 13 German Championships and takes 29 first places within just a few years.
Since 1951, the 'Veritas-Nürburgring' is made in the pits of the Nürburgring racetrack.
In the same year, the unparalleled development of the racing team is crowned by the participation of a Veritas Meteor in the Swiss Formula 1 Grand Prix:
Which makes the Veritas the first German Formula 1 racing car ever.
